A heavy, rounded display face with inflated, pillow-like strokes and fully softened terminals. Letterforms are simplified and highly geometric in spirit, but with deliberately uneven curves and slightly wobbly contours that create an informal, hand-made rhythm. Counters are small and rounded, apertures tend to be tight, and joins are blunted, producing compact interior space and a strong silhouette. The lowercase shows single-storey forms and a casual, slightly lopsided stance, with generous curves and minimal straight segments throughout.

Best suited to punchy display settings such as children’s products, playful branding, packaging callouts, posters, and social graphics. It also works well for stickers, labels, and short UI/streamer overlays where a friendly, high-impact voice is needed.

The overall tone is cheerful and approachable, with a humorous, cartoon sensibility. Its puffy shapes and soft edges feel welcoming and lighthearted, lending a youthful, snackable energy to headlines and short phrases.

The design appears intended to deliver maximum friendliness and impact through soft, inflated shapes and an intentionally imperfect, hand-drawn finish. It prioritizes character and warmth over strict regularity, aiming for expressive, attention-grabbing display typography.

Because the counters and apertures are relatively closed at this weight, clarity drops as sizes get smaller or when spacing is tight. It reads best when allowed a bit of breathing room, where the rounded silhouettes and bouncy spacing can carry the personality.
